How much did Warren Buffett make on these 2 massive oil bets in 2026

Summary by Finbold
By the start of 2026, Warren Buffett’s long-standing positions in two oil giants – Chevron (NYSE: CVX) and Occidental Petroleum (NYSE: OXY) – not only grew to a combined $30.5 billion but soon proved some of his most successful investments.
